Clearline unveils 5 kW solar energy system

July 2011 Electrical Power & Protection

Clearline Power Solutions, a division of Clearline Protection Systems, has successfully launched its unique solar energy supply system in the South African market. The standard unit is 5 kW output rated, however this can be tailored to generate greater or smaller power outputs depending on the installation.

The system is equally suitable for installation in developed or rural areas without the need for any specialised equipment, infrastructure or electrical connections. The patented design and delivery system ensures that power is available to users 24 hours per day, monitored remotely through a GSM link to ascertain usage patterns and ensure that adequate supply is always available. The system can be configured as pre-paid, billed or free supply electricity depending on local conditions.

Some of the applications for this innovative system are in domestic housing (urban and rural), borehole and surface pumps, electric fences, lodges, game farms, gatehouses, traffic control and perimeter and street lighting. Clearline has successfully installed systems in several locations, particularly in rural Eastern Cape and KwaZulu-Natal, where grid power is not economical to install due to cable lengths or lack of capacity.

Using one of the system’s unique features to track the arc of the sun and maximising its effectiveness as a power source, Clearline has installed a totally solar powered solution in cellular phone tower applications. This has allowed the operating company independence from the grid, saving it operating expenses and eliminating downtime due to power interruptions.

Equipment is typically supplied flat packed to allow for cost-effective bulk transportation, once on site it can be set up and commissioned within a day.
